Description |
English: Rolled pillow back and front seat rail; so-called "turtle" slat stencilled with design of footed bowl of fruits. Turned straight front legs on button feet. Four lateral and two longitudinal turned stretchers. Caned seat. Gilt bandings on black ground. |
